Pooled CRISPR screens with transcriptomics readout arrived for bacteria. We introduce mapSPLiT, an approach to profiling transcriptional responses to CRISPR perturbations at scale. Collaborative work with Carothers, Zalatan, and Seelig groups at UW&@isbscience.org www.biorxiv.org/content/10.6... 1/4

Pooled single-cell CRISPRa/i screens for functional genomics in bacteria at scale

Pooled CRISPR screens using single-cell RNA sequencing (scRNA-seq) have emerged as powerful tools to uncover gene function, map regulatory networks, and identify genetic interactions. However, the inh...

Finally caught up with some beautiful work from Alex Meeske in Nature! His lab has identified proteins in Listeria that either substitute for Cas in Cascade complexes (anti-type I-B CRISPR immunity) or degrade crRNA (anti-type VI-A CRISPR immunity). Inspiring stuff! www.nature.com/articles/s41...

Diverse viral cas genes antagonize CRISPR immunity - Nature

We demonstrate that phages have co-opted cas genes from CRISPR defence systems, which subsequently evolved anti-defence functions.
